Chemical Structure
Kanjone
- CAS No.: 1094-12-8
- Formula:C18H12O4
- Molecular Weight:292.29
InChIKey: OVAZJVLXWGEKHQ-UHFFFAOYSA-N
SMILES: O=C1C=C(C2=CC=CC=C2)OC3=C4C=COC4=C(OC)C=C31
Biological Activity: Kanjone is a compound found in Millettia peguensis and can be used for the synthesis of protein tyrosine phosphatase 1B (PTP1B) inhibitors. Kanjone holds promise for research in the fields of diabetes and neurological disorders[1].
